Whether through flooding due to a storm, a burst pipeline, wetness trapped underneath walls or floors, spaces in a tile shower, structure fractures, a leaking toilet, water damage after a fire, or a dripping roofing system, too much wetness left alone inside your home can lead to much larger issues. Not all water damage is equal; water from” clean” sources such as.
a pipe or rain is much easier and less expensive to clean up, while water from a backed up sewage system pipe or a leakage that’s only discovered after mold has grown is going to be more tough and more expensive to clean. Expenses continue to increase from here depending on the source of the water, how much.
water, and how excellent the damage. A leakage or burst pipeline might seem only bothersome, but water can do a great deal of damage to your home if not tidied up in a timely way. The growth of mold or mildew on both tough and soft surface areas.
Softening and decaying of wood and other natural products. Spots caused by minerals or particles in the water permeating into porous products such as stone or wood. The spread of germs or illness in water from infected sources like sewers. All of these issues are also significantly more costly to fix or get rid of from your home than simply the initial wetness. This is why it’s important to handle water or leakages as soon as they are discovered, ideally within the very first 24 to two days to make sure that additional problems don’t develop. For that reason, it’s advised that you follow these steps before they show up to assist deal with the damage: Shut off the power to the afflicted area to prevent electrical fires. Mop up or bail out as much water as you can without utilizing any electrical appliances. Move art work, photos, and ornamental products to a safe location.
to dry. Open up cabinets and doors to help facilitate drying. Wipe down any walls or home furnishings that have a little quantity of wetness on them. Open any windows to help air out the area. Every situation handling water inside your house is going to be a little different, which may suggest that the actual procedure of restoration.
may vary for your residential or commercial property too. Nevertheless, the general steps taken will likely look like the following: The repair group will make a thorough evaluation of your home and the possible damage to produce a plan. Next, your residential or commercial property will be dried completely with making use of dehumidifiers and fans. Movable items may be removed to an offsite place for cleaning, including your furnishings, drapes, toss carpets, and kids’s toys. They will be thoroughly sterilized and ventilated prior to being returned. Lastly, your house will be sterilized and deodorized utilizing a mix of fogging equipment, air scrubbers, and antimicrobial treatments.
